Important
S afety Instructions
When using your telephone equipment, basic safety precautions should always
be followed to reduce the risk of fire, electrical shock, and injury to persons,
including the following:
1. Read and understand all instructions.
2. Follow all warnings and instructions marked on the product.
3. Unplug this product from the wall outlet before cleaning. Do not use liquid
cleaners or aerosol cleaners. Use a dry cloth for cleaning.
4. Do not use this product near water; for example, near a bath tub, wash bowl,
kitchen sink or laundry tub, in a wet basement, or near a swimming pool.
5. Do not place this product on an unstable cart, stand, or table. The telephone
may fall, causing serious damage to the unit.
6. Slots and openings in the cabinet and the back or bottom are provided for
ventilation. To protect the product from overheating, these openings must
not be blocked or covered. These openings should never be blocked by
placing the product on a bed, sofa, rug, or other similar surface. This
product should never be placed near or over a radiator or heat register.
This product should not be placed in a bui~-in installation unless prope~
ventilation is provided.
7. This product should be operated only from the type of power source indicated
on the markinglabel. Ifyou are notsure ofthe typeof power supplyto yourho me,
consult your dealer or local power company.
8. Do not allow anything to rest on the power cord. Do not locate this product
where the cord will be damaged by personswalking on it.
9. Do not overload wall outlets and extension cords, as this can result in the risk
of fire or electrical shock.
1O. Never push obj~s
of any kind into this product through cabinet slots, as they may
touch dangerous voltage points or short out parts that could result in a risk
of fire or electrical shock. Never spill liquid of any kind on the product.
11. To reduce the risk of electrical shock, do not disassemble this product.
Take it to qualified service personnel when some service or repair work
is required. Opening or removing covers may expose you to dangerous
voltages or other risks. Incorrect reassembly can cause electrical shock
when the appliance is subsequently used.
